Bare ActsThe MAHE LAND REFORMS ACT, 1968

Section 80R

(1) Any amount paid by way of rent by the cultivating tenant in respect of his holding to the landowner or any intermediary or the Government for the period after the date of vesting of the right, title and interest of the landowner and the intermediaries in respect of the holding in the Government under section 80 shall be adjusted towards the purchase price payable by the cultivating tenant and such amount received by the landowner or any intermediary shall be adjusted towards the compensation payable to him under section 80J. (2) Where consequent on the determination of the fair rent in respect of a holding, the rent payable by the cultivating tenant to the landowner or any intermediary has been reduced, the amount paid by the cultivating tenant in excess of the rent so determined to the landowner or the intermediary for the period commencing on the beginning of the agricultural year in which the cultivating tenant filed the application for such determination and ending with the date of such determination shall be adjusted towards the purchase price payable by the cultivating tenant and such amount received by the landowner or any intermediary shall be adjusted towards the compensation payable to him under section 80A. 142 Applications under section 62 and proceedings relating thereto to abate on the date notified under section 80
